Marcel Werk [Wed, 30 Nov 2016 11:16:12 +0000 (12:16 +0100)]
Merge pull request #2142 from woouki/master
Fix "DailyMotion" media bbcode
Marcel Werk [Wed, 30 Nov 2016 10:53:51 +0000 (11:53 +0100)]
Merge pull request #2141 from woouki/master
Fixed some english language variables
Marcel Werk [Tue, 29 Nov 2016 17:21:31 +0000 (18:21 +0100)]
Overhauled cookie policy notice
Marcel Werk [Mon, 28 Nov 2016 16:17:48 +0000 (17:17 +0100)]
Overhauled buttons in mobile user-panel
Tim Düsterhus [Sun, 27 Nov 2016 23:03:33 +0000 (00:03 +0100)]
Silence warnings on invalid images in image proxy
Tim Düsterhus [Sun, 27 Nov 2016 23:02:23 +0000 (00:02 +0100)]
Set Accept header in image proxy
Tim Düsterhus [Sun, 27 Nov 2016 22:57:26 +0000 (23:57 +0100)]
Fix yet another potential DoS vulnerability in image proxy
This prevents the image proxy requesting images from itself.
Matthias Schmidt [Sun, 27 Nov 2016 15:25:03 +0000 (16:25 +0100)]
Merge branch '2.1'
Matthias Schmidt [Sun, 27 Nov 2016 15:23:45 +0000 (16:23 +0100)]
Fix text transparency in ImagickImageAdapter::drawText()
woouki [Sun, 27 Nov 2016 14:52:25 +0000 (15:52 +0100)]
Fix "DailyMotion" media bbcode
See https://developer.dailymotion.com/player#player-parameters
Matthias Schmidt [Sun, 27 Nov 2016 14:49:23 +0000 (15:49 +0100)]
Add ImagickException as previous exception for SystemException
Matthias Schmidt [Sun, 27 Nov 2016 14:34:52 +0000 (15:34 +0100)]
Merge branch '2.1'
Matthias Schmidt [Sun, 27 Nov 2016 14:31:25 +0000 (15:31 +0100)]
Improve upload file handling for file option type
In `IUploadFileValidationStrategy::validate()`, you now get proper
values for `UploadFile::getImageData()`, for example.
woouki [Sun, 27 Nov 2016 13:53:06 +0000 (14:53 +0100)]
Fixed some english language variables
See https://beta.woltlab.com/forum/thread/1711-letzte-kleine-acp-korrekturen-englisch/
Matthias Schmidt [Sun, 27 Nov 2016 13:22:13 +0000 (14:22 +0100)]
Fix category validation in AbstractCategorizedACPSearchResultProvider
Marcel Werk [Sun, 27 Nov 2016 13:05:18 +0000 (14:05 +0100)]
Overhauled media-bbcode
Marcel Werk [Sun, 27 Nov 2016 12:26:10 +0000 (13:26 +0100)]
Fixed invalid tag in amp template
woltlab.com [Sun, 27 Nov 2016 12:16:45 +0000 (13:16 +0100)]
Updating minified JavaScript files
Marcel Werk [Sun, 27 Nov 2016 12:14:37 +0000 (13:14 +0100)]
Fixed onClose callback in datepicker
Marcel Werk [Sun, 27 Nov 2016 10:14:05 +0000 (11:14 +0100)]
Fixed page logo preview in style editor
woltlab.com [Sat, 26 Nov 2016 23:46:44 +0000 (00:46 +0100)]
Updating minified JavaScript files
Alexander Ebert [Sat, 26 Nov 2016 23:40:06 +0000 (00:40 +0100)]
Fixed caret position after pasting
Marcel Werk [Sat, 26 Nov 2016 23:00:11 +0000 (00:00 +0100)]
Unified phrases
Marcel Werk [Sat, 26 Nov 2016 22:43:32 +0000 (23:43 +0100)]
Merge pull request #2140 from woouki/master
Fixed some german language variables
Marcel Werk [Sat, 26 Nov 2016 19:04:50 +0000 (20:04 +0100)]
Overhauled default box menu styling
woouki [Sat, 26 Nov 2016 14:26:19 +0000 (15:26 +0100)]
Fixed some german language variables
See https://beta.woltlab.com/forum/thread/1689-kleine-acp-korrekturen-deutsch/
Fixed 3, 5 and 6. The issues in 2, 4 and 7 are commercial products.
Alexander Ebert [Sat, 26 Nov 2016 13:45:28 +0000 (14:45 +0100)]
Work-around for low resolutions or double sidebars
Marcel Werk [Sat, 26 Nov 2016 13:44:36 +0000 (14:44 +0100)]
Merge pull request #2139 from woouki/master
Fix timestamp language variables in en.xml / de.xml
woouki [Sat, 26 Nov 2016 13:05:31 +0000 (14:05 +0100)]
Fix timestamp language variables in de.xml
see https://beta.woltlab.com/forum/thread/1685-sprachvariablen/
woouki [Sat, 26 Nov 2016 13:04:33 +0000 (14:04 +0100)]
Fix timestamp language variables in en.xml
see https://beta.woltlab.com/forum/thread/1685-sprachvariablen/
Alexander Ebert [Sat, 26 Nov 2016 12:36:21 +0000 (13:36 +0100)]
Fixed visuals for active sub menu items on mobile
woltlab.com [Sat, 26 Nov 2016 12:16:46 +0000 (13:16 +0100)]
Updating minified JavaScript files
Alexander Ebert [Sat, 26 Nov 2016 11:51:46 +0000 (12:51 +0100)]
Avoid weird element focus on installation start
Alexander Ebert [Sat, 26 Nov 2016 11:39:46 +0000 (12:39 +0100)]
Merge branch 'master' of github.com:WoltLab/WCF
Alexander Ebert [Sat, 26 Nov 2016 11:15:00 +0000 (12:15 +0100)]
Fixed spinner icon
woltlab.com [Fri, 25 Nov 2016 17:16:46 +0000 (18:16 +0100)]
Updating minified JavaScript files
Alexander Ebert [Fri, 25 Nov 2016 17:00:52 +0000 (18:00 +0100)]
Fixed nested collapsible bbcode
Alexander Ebert [Fri, 25 Nov 2016 16:26:01 +0000 (17:26 +0100)]
Fixed quote bbcode nesting
Alexander Ebert [Fri, 25 Nov 2016 14:57:20 +0000 (15:57 +0100)]
Improved list bbcode conversion
Alexander Ebert [Fri, 25 Nov 2016 14:40:08 +0000 (15:40 +0100)]
Fixed layout issue in IE 11
Marcel Werk [Fri, 25 Nov 2016 11:46:30 +0000 (12:46 +0100)]
Fixed wrapping of buttons in flexibleButtonGroup
Alexander Ebert [Thu, 24 Nov 2016 18:46:40 +0000 (19:46 +0100)]
Added update instructions for sessionVariables
Alexander Ebert [Thu, 24 Nov 2016 18:10:43 +0000 (19:10 +0100)]
Fixed ACP layout issue
Alexander Ebert [Thu, 24 Nov 2016 18:10:35 +0000 (19:10 +0100)]
Fixed column definition
Alexander Ebert [Thu, 24 Nov 2016 17:51:27 +0000 (18:51 +0100)]
Moved `sessionVariables` back
Marcel Werk [Thu, 24 Nov 2016 16:08:18 +0000 (17:08 +0100)]
Added method to retrieve number of articles per category
woltlab.com [Thu, 24 Nov 2016 15:46:46 +0000 (16:46 +0100)]
Updating minified JavaScript files
Alexander Ebert [Thu, 24 Nov 2016 15:33:00 +0000 (16:33 +0100)]
Added overflow handling for main menu
Marcel Werk [Thu, 24 Nov 2016 10:23:30 +0000 (11:23 +0100)]
Added option to change sort order of articles
Marcel Werk [Wed, 23 Nov 2016 22:08:49 +0000 (23:08 +0100)]
Fixed wrong icon name
Marcel Werk [Wed, 23 Nov 2016 13:26:33 +0000 (14:26 +0100)]
Fixed broken box-shadow
Alexander Ebert [Wed, 23 Nov 2016 10:57:25 +0000 (11:57 +0100)]
Added a missing description
Alexander Ebert [Tue, 22 Nov 2016 16:58:52 +0000 (17:58 +0100)]
Fixed SQL update
Alexander Ebert [Tue, 22 Nov 2016 14:36:50 +0000 (15:36 +0100)]
Preparing release 3.0.0 Beta 5
Marcel Werk [Mon, 21 Nov 2016 22:18:39 +0000 (23:18 +0100)]
Improved attachment styling
Alexander Ebert [Mon, 21 Nov 2016 17:12:28 +0000 (18:12 +0100)]
Added work-around for broken controllers
Alexander Ebert [Sun, 20 Nov 2016 19:30:09 +0000 (20:30 +0100)]
Use a combined script to drop columns
Matthias Schmidt [Sun, 20 Nov 2016 15:24:46 +0000 (16:24 +0100)]
Fix method parameter comment
Alexander Ebert [Sun, 20 Nov 2016 15:15:26 +0000 (16:15 +0100)]
Split update.sql into 5 chunks
Alexander Ebert [Sun, 20 Nov 2016 14:36:31 +0000 (15:36 +0100)]
Added work-around for cache reset for scripts pip
Alexander Ebert [Sun, 20 Nov 2016 12:31:50 +0000 (13:31 +0100)]
Fixed line counting
Alexander Ebert [Sun, 20 Nov 2016 12:14:32 +0000 (13:14 +0100)]
Added worker script to handle column resizing
Matthias Schmidt [Sun, 20 Nov 2016 15:10:08 +0000 (16:10 +0100)]
Deprecate `Callback` class
Since PHP 5.4, the `callback` type hint is available.
Matthias Schmidt [Sun, 20 Nov 2016 14:35:25 +0000 (15:35 +0100)]
`IBulkProcessingAction::executeAction()` throws `\InvalidArgumentException`
Marcel Werk [Sun, 20 Nov 2016 10:33:13 +0000 (11:33 +0100)]
Colors in amp version are no longer hard-coded
Alexander Ebert [Sun, 20 Nov 2016 09:51:15 +0000 (10:51 +0100)]
Improved phrasing for expired session/invalid token
Alexander Ebert [Sat, 19 Nov 2016 20:07:36 +0000 (21:07 +0100)]
Disallow rebuilding data before encoding conversion
Alexander Ebert [Sat, 19 Nov 2016 19:23:08 +0000 (20:23 +0100)]
Added a worker for utf8 -> utf8mb4 conversion
Marcel Werk [Sat, 19 Nov 2016 18:44:41 +0000 (19:44 +0100)]
Hide message signature in mobile view
Marcel Werk [Sat, 19 Nov 2016 18:30:54 +0000 (19:30 +0100)]
Fixed style issue in avatar form
woltlab.com [Sat, 19 Nov 2016 01:16:43 +0000 (02:16 +0100)]
Updating minified JavaScript files
Tim Düsterhus [Sat, 19 Nov 2016 01:11:09 +0000 (02:11 +0100)]
Update to require.js 2.3.2
Marcel Werk [Fri, 18 Nov 2016 17:31:46 +0000 (18:31 +0100)]
Update template listener XSD
woltlab.com [Fri, 18 Nov 2016 16:55:24 +0000 (17:55 +0100)]
Updating minified JavaScript files
Alexander Ebert [Fri, 18 Nov 2016 16:51:05 +0000 (17:51 +0100)]
Fixed AJAX exception handling
Alexander Ebert [Fri, 18 Nov 2016 12:57:26 +0000 (13:57 +0100)]
Fixed regex length for smiley codes
Patterns are now limited to roughly 30k characters each to avoid hitting
PCRE pattern limits.
woltlab.com [Fri, 18 Nov 2016 11:31:45 +0000 (12:31 +0100)]
Updating minified JavaScript files
Alexander Ebert [Fri, 18 Nov 2016 11:29:01 +0000 (12:29 +0100)]
Fixed handling of "empty" messages
Alexander Ebert [Fri, 18 Nov 2016 10:57:22 +0000 (11:57 +0100)]
Fixed outdated regex
Alexander Ebert [Fri, 18 Nov 2016 10:53:34 +0000 (11:53 +0100)]
Added `wcfDebug()` support during WCFSetup
Alexander Ebert [Fri, 18 Nov 2016 10:50:03 +0000 (11:50 +0100)]
Fixed exception output during WCFSetup
Marcel Werk [Thu, 17 Nov 2016 22:10:09 +0000 (23:10 +0100)]
Fixed multiple issues in xml files
Alexander Ebert [Thu, 17 Nov 2016 22:08:07 +0000 (23:08 +0100)]
Previous regex was incomplete
Marcel Werk [Thu, 17 Nov 2016 21:03:47 +0000 (22:03 +0100)]
Merge pull request #2138 from joshuaruesweg/patch-84
Add User parameter for label permissions
Matthias Schmidt [Thu, 17 Nov 2016 18:45:29 +0000 (19:45 +0100)]
Remove obsolete import
Joshua Rüsweg [Thu, 17 Nov 2016 17:30:28 +0000 (18:30 +0100)]
Add User parameter for label permissions
Marcel Werk [Thu, 17 Nov 2016 17:22:03 +0000 (18:22 +0100)]
Updated XSD files
Tim Düsterhus [Thu, 17 Nov 2016 16:46:14 +0000 (17:46 +0100)]
Improve StringUtil::trim()
The previous regular expression for trim at the end
(introduced in
73d8b58f6a2ed1c9f49684e867d2b42a8cd82920) show bad
performance for huge strings containing little amounts of white space.
The version before that one blew the C stack for huge strings containing
huge amounts of contiguous white space.
Matching for the Unicode property of being a whitespace is both faster
(less backtracking for alternations) *and* more correct (because it
matches many more types of white space).
win-win
Marcel Werk [Thu, 17 Nov 2016 16:41:23 +0000 (17:41 +0100)]
Added missing menu items
Alexander Ebert [Thu, 17 Nov 2016 14:02:20 +0000 (15:02 +0100)]
Fixed PHP crash on Windows
Using `textContent` to wipe the node contents causes PHP's internal data
structures to be corrupted on Windows.
woltlab.com [Thu, 17 Nov 2016 12:01:46 +0000 (13:01 +0100)]
Updating minified JavaScript files
Alexander Ebert [Thu, 17 Nov 2016 11:50:00 +0000 (12:50 +0100)]
Fixed dialog id collision
Alexander Ebert [Thu, 17 Nov 2016 11:49:34 +0000 (12:49 +0100)]
Fixed infinite loop during mention parsing
Alexander Ebert [Thu, 17 Nov 2016 10:53:08 +0000 (11:53 +0100)]
Improved trimming regex
The old regex cause a segmentation fault when dealing with very large
chunks of whitespace not at the end of the string.
woltlab.com [Wed, 16 Nov 2016 15:16:46 +0000 (16:16 +0100)]
Updating minified JavaScript files
Alexander Ebert [Wed, 16 Nov 2016 14:46:45 +0000 (15:46 +0100)]
Fixed handling of empty lines
Alexander Ebert [Wed, 16 Nov 2016 14:30:50 +0000 (15:30 +0100)]
Strip dummy paragraphs
Alexander Ebert [Wed, 16 Nov 2016 12:51:35 +0000 (13:51 +0100)]
Fixed popover flicker on re-entry
Alexander Ebert [Wed, 16 Nov 2016 12:01:37 +0000 (13:01 +0100)]
Added tab index support for package search results
Alexander Ebert [Wed, 16 Nov 2016 11:53:38 +0000 (12:53 +0100)]
Fixed source formatting and quote content